The Factoidals

Fabric: grey interlock knit (Ribas y Casals), and an ol' yellow RISD t-shirt
Pattern: Our Own Pretty Ways - Style A (free w/registration on YSR)
Year: contemporary
Notions: snaps, fusible interfacing, some elastic
Time to complete: 4 hours
First worn: this week
Wear again? Yes!
Total price: about 8 EUR (for the grey knit)


Modifications to the pattern...

I didn't have a ribbed band for the bottom edge, so I just used t-shirt. I used 2 colors for the hood grey/yellow. I omitted the drawstring - my eyelet/grommet maker was malfunctioning and wrecking the fabric so I passed for now. Instead of hook and eye closures I used snaps. The sleeves were a bit droopy for me, but I'll live with it. I tried applying an elastic band w/contrasting yellow, but it just wasn't working. The shape + fabric just isn't meant to be gathered...at least not yet by me and my handy-dandy skillz. :D

I do feel that knit fabric is way more forgiving than I expected it to be. I'm really pleased with the results!
